Seasonal worker

A seasonal worker is a foreign national, who is to be engaged in typical seasonal work, such as harvesting or picking berries, or as an ordinary summer holiday replacement. A seasonal activity is a type of activity, which can only be carried out for a limited part of the year.

Legislation
  • A work permit for a seasonal worker may be granted for up to six months, and a new permit cannot be granted until the applicant has been abroad (outside the actual country) for six months.
  • Prior to applying for a seasonal work permit, the applicant must have a concrete offer of employment and a job contract.
  • A work permit for a seasonal worker is valid for a particular job and particular place of employment.
  • Wages and terms of employment may not be less favourable than what is normal in Norway.
  • A person for whom a visa is required and who is lawfully in Norway and wishes to apply for a seasonal work permit may apply from Norway.
  • A seasonal work permit does not constitute ground for a settlement permit.
  • A seasonal worker is obligated to return to the country of origin immediately after the work contract is expired.
